Anguina tritici, commonly referred to as wheat seed gall nematode, is the cause of earcockle disease. Its host range includes wheat, triticale, rye, and related grasses. Wheat is the most important grain crop, a staple food for more than onethird of the world population. Ear cockle disease reduces human consumption and market price of wheat paruthi and bhatti, 1988,with significant reduction in the protein and gluten contents of the flour product of infested wheat with seed galls mustafa, 2009. The seed gall nematode, cause of the earcockle disease of wheat and barley was the first described plantparasitic nematode in the literature. Conclusions in typical bacterial earrot disease, nematodes were not found in infected tissues.
